Real-Time Active Noise Cancellation with Simulink and Data Acquisition Toolbox
نویسندگان
چکیده
This paper presents the feasibility of implementing single channel negative feedback Active Noise Cancellation technique using adaptive filters in Real-time environment[1]. In order to establish the suitability and credibility of LMS Algorithm for adaptive filtering in real world scenario, its efficiency was tested beyond system based ideal simulations. Within the MATLAB® software environment two different methods were used to perform Real-time ANC namely Simulink® and Data Acquisition ToolboxTM. Human voice is used as test signal. For processing and performing adaptive filtering, Block LMS Filter was utilised in Simulink and Error Normalised Step Size algorithm was used in between input and output of Signals by DAQ (Data Acquisition) toolbox interface. A general method of using DAQ commands has been employed which also allows for almost any kind of complex real-time audio processing and is quite easy to follow.
منابع مشابه
Feature Extraction of Visual Evoked Potentials Using Wavelet Transform and Singular Value Decomposition
Introduction: Brain visual evoked potential (VEP) signals are commonly known to be accompanied by high levels of background noise typically from the spontaneous background brain activity of electroencephalography (EEG) signals. Material and Methods: A model based on dyadic filter bank, discrete wavelet transform (DWT), and singular value decomposition (SVD) was developed to analyze the raw data...
متن کاملActive Noise Cancellation using Online Wavelet Based Control System: Numerical and Experimental Study
Reaction wheels (RWs) used for attitude control of space vehicle systems usually encounter with undesired wide band noises. These noises which significantly affect the performance of regulator controller must tune the review or review rate of RWs. According to wide frequency band of noises in RWs the common approaches of noise cancellation cannot conveniently reduce the effects of the noise. Th...
متن کاملAdaptive-Filtering-Based Algorithm for Impulsive Noise Cancellation from ECG Signal
Suppression of noise and artifacts is a necessary step in biomedical data processing. Adaptive filtering is known as useful method to overcome this problem. Among various contaminants, there are some situations such as electrical activities of muscles contribute to impulsive noise. This paper deals with modeling real-life muscle noise with α-stable probability distribution and adaptive filterin...
متن کاملEfficient Implementation of Adaptive Noise Canceller Using FPGA for Automobile Applications
This paper presents the architecture and implementation of a real time adaptive NLMS filter for nonstationary noise cancellation in a car environment.The active noise control techniques using adaptive digital filters are very much suitable and well proven.The proposed efficient Adaptive Noise Canceller is realized using Xilinx System Generator 12.3 on Spartan 3E FPGA. System Generator is a DSP ...
متن کاملThe Development of a Self-balancing Vehicle: a Platform for Education in Mechatronics
This paper deals with the development of a low cost self-balancing vehicle aimed to be used as a teaching tool. Matlab/Simulink tools intensively supported the development process. According to the model-based design approach, an electro-mechanical model was created as an initial step. The mechanical part was implemented into SimMechanics, and a DC motor was considered as a static system. Next,...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2012